What is a production associate?

Production Associates are entry-level workers who assist in the manufacturing process within factories or production facilities. Their responsibilities typically include assembling products, operating machinery, monitoring production lines, and ensuring quality standards are met. They may also be responsible for packaging, labeling, and basic maintenance of equipment. Production Associates play a crucial role in maintaining efficient workflow and supporting higher-level technicians or supervisors. The role often requires attention to detail, manual dexterity, and the ability to follow safety protocols.

What does a production associate do?

A production associate’s job duties depend on the industry in which they work. If you’re a manufacturing production associate, then your responsibilities include maintaining production equipment and assemblies, ensuring quality control, overseeing manufacturing personnel, ordering materials, monitoring packaging and shipping of the product, and handling clerical tasks like work orders and documentation. As a production associate in the film and TV industry, your duties include hiring and scheduling actors and technical staff, resolving technical challenges such as equipment failure, and maintaining relationships with suppliers and vendors.

What are some typical challenges production associates face when adjusting to fast-paced manufacturing environments?

Production Associates often encounter challenges such as adapting to rapidly changing production schedules, maintaining high attention to detail while working efficiently, and learning to operate various machinery safely. Additionally, they must quickly become familiar with strict quality standards and safety protocols. Collaborating effectively with team members and supervisors is essential to ensure smooth workflow and meet production targets.

The main difference between a Production Associate and a Manufacturing Technician lies in their responsibilities and skill requirements. Production Associates typically perform basic assembly and packaging tasks with minimal technical training, while Manufacturing Technicians handle equipment maintenance, troubleshooting, and more technical duties. Both roles are essential in manufacturing environments, but Manufacturing Technicians usually require additional technical certifications or vocational training.

What is an entry-level production associate?

An entry-level production associate is a worker who performs basic tasks on a manufacturing or production line, often requiring minimal prior experience. They typically handle tasks such as assembling products, operating machinery, and maintaining a clean work environment, with opportunities to learn skills and advance within the company.

The Salvation Army's Adult Rehabilitation Centers make a difference in people's lives. Through the collection and resale of gently used goods we are able to provide the financial support to assist men and women with a variety of social and spiritual afflictions. The in-residence rehabilitation program focuses on basic necessities with every man or woman being provided a clean and healthy living environment, good food, work therapy, leisure time activities, group and individual counseling, and spiritual direction. All our effort is focused on developing life skills and a personal relationship with God through Jesus Christ. More than just a job, each member of the team contributes to recycling goods that literally recycle and repair broken lives.
